Lagos government commences sensitization to implore dropout back to school

Date:

AISHA ADESHINA

Lagos State government has begin public enlightenment campaign to educate School dropout especially young girls on the need to go back to school to complete their education for a better future.

Special adviser to Governor Babajide Sanwo-Olu on education, Barrister Tokunbo Wahab, speaking during a sensitisation programme by his office in Amuwo-odofin local council to sensitize residents on the importance to re-enroll School dropout, entreat the girl child who dropped out of school as a result of early marriage, poverty, early pregnancy or other factors to take back to their education and learn vocation that would make them become entrepreneur and self-sufficient.

He added, that in line with the state government’s vision for mass literacy for sustainable development, plans are set to build five new alternative schools in the state in addition to the one in agboju, education district 5.

The Special Adviser was represented at the street to street public enlightenment campaign by the chairman of the governing board of the alternative high school for girls Agboju, Mrs Funmilola Olajide, made it known that education remains a strong weapon to fight poverty and ignorance, adding that the vision for a new Lagos with education and technology in the six pillar development agenda of the state government could only be achieved when residents are well educated and enlightened.
